All warnings (new ones prefixed by >>):

kernel/sched/fair.c: In function 'idle_balance':
>> kernel/sched/fair.c:9865:15: warning: assignment makes integer from pointer without a cast [-Wint-conversion]
pulled_task = RETRY_TASK;
^

vim +9865 kernel/sched/fair.c

9757
9758 /*
9759 * idle_balance is called by schedule() if this_cpu is about to become
9760 * idle. Attempts to pull tasks from other CPUs.
9761 */
9762 static int idle_balance(struct rq *this_rq, struct rq_flags *rf)
9763 {
9764 unsigned long next_balance = jiffies + HZ;
9765 int this_cpu = this_rq->cpu;
9766 struct sched_domain *sd;
9767 int pulled_task = 0;
9768 u64 curr_cost = 0;
9769
9770 /*
9771 * We must set idle_stamp _before_ calling idle_balance(), such that we
9772 * measure the duration of idle_balance() as idle time.
9773 */
9774 this_rq->idle_stamp = rq_clock(this_rq);
9775
9776 /*
9777 * Do not pull tasks towards !active CPUs...
9778 */
9779 if (!cpu_active(this_cpu))
9780 return 0;
9781
9782 /*
9783 * This is OK, because current is on_cpu, which avoids it being picked
9784 * for load-balance and preemption/IRQs are still disabled avoiding
9785 * further scheduler activity on it and we're being very careful to
9786 * re-start the picking loop.
9787 */
9788 rq_unpin_lock(this_rq, rf);
9789
9790 if (this_rq->avg_idle < sysctl_sched_migration_cost ||
9791 !this_rq->rd->overload) {
9792
9793 rcu_read_lock();
9794 sd = rcu_dereference_check_sched_domain(this_rq->sd);
9795 if (sd)
9796 update_next_balance(sd, &next_balance);
9797 rcu_read_unlock();
9798
9799 nohz_newidle_balance(this_rq);
9800
9801 goto out;
9802 }
9803
9804 raw_spin_unlock(&this_rq->lock);
9805
9806 update_blocked_averages(this_cpu);
9807 rcu_read_lock();
9808 for_each_domain(this_cpu, sd) {
9809 int continue_balancing = 1;
9810 u64 t0, domain_cost;
9811
9812 if (!(sd->flags & SD_LOAD_BALANCE))
9813 continue;
9814
9815 if (this_rq->avg_idle < curr_cost + sd->max_newidle_lb_cost) {
9816 update_next_balance(sd, &next_balance);
9817 break;
9818 }
9819
9820 if (sd->flags & SD_BALANCE_NEWIDLE) {
9821 t0 = sched_clock_cpu(this_cpu);
9822
9823 pulled_task = load_balance(this_cpu, this_rq,
9824 sd, CPU_NEWLY_IDLE,
9825 &continue_balancing);
9826
9827 domain_cost = sched_clock_cpu(this_cpu) - t0;
9828 if (domain_cost > sd->max_newidle_lb_cost)
9829 sd->max_newidle_lb_cost = domain_cost;
9830
9831 curr_cost += domain_cost;
9832 }
9833
9834 update_next_balance(sd, &next_balance);
9835
9836 /*
9837 * Stop searching for tasks to pull if there are
9838 * now runnable tasks on this rq.
9839 */
9840 if (pulled_task || this_rq->nr_running > 0)
9841 break;
9842 }
9843 rcu_read_unlock();
9844
9845 raw_spin_lock(&this_rq->lock);
9846
9847 if (curr_cost > this_rq->max_idle_balance_cost)
9848 this_rq->max_idle_balance_cost = curr_cost;
9849
9850 /*
9851 * While browsing the domains, we released the rq lock, a task could
9852 * have been enqueued in the meantime. Since we're not going idle,
9853 * pretend we pulled a task.
9854 */
9855 if (this_rq->cfs.h_nr_running && !pulled_task)
9856 pulled_task = 1;
9857
9858 out:
9859 /* Move the next balance forward */
9860 if (time_after(this_rq->next_balance, next_balance))
9861 this_rq->next_balance = next_balance;
9862
9863 /* Is there a task of a high priority class? */
9864 if (this_rq->nr_running != this_rq->cfs.h_nr_running)
> 9865 pulled_task = RETRY_TASK;
9866
9867 if (pulled_task)
9868 this_rq->idle_stamp = 0;
9869
9870 rq_repin_lock(this_rq, rf);
9871
9872 return pulled_task;
9873 }
9874
